扫描器()如何保持printf的输出不出现在屏幕上?循环必须是迭代的,因为i的值正在增加,如输出所示。为了澄清,循环如何迭代而不显示printf的输出?代码:char chr = 0;printf("Please enter the string you would like reversed= '\n'&& i<99) scanf(
当调用任何从stdin读取的内容时,我总是碰到分段错误。我不知道为什么。从某个函数中调用getchar()或任何其他类似的函数都会导致程序崩溃,但是当我从另一个函数调用它时,它可以正常工作。printf("Item:\n\n"); printf("%d) %s\n", i, getItemName(i));}